Myth 1: Premium Fuel is Always Better

Many believe that using premium fuel enhances performance, but for most vehicles, regular fuel is sufficient unless specified otherwise by the manufacturer.

Myth 2: You Should Change Oil Every 3,000 Miles

With advancements in oil technology, many vehicles can now go longer between oil changes. Always refer to your owner's manual for the recommended intervals.

Myth 3: The More You Drive, the Better It Is for Your Car

Excessive driving can lead to wear and tear. Regular maintenance is key regardless of how often you drive.

Myth 4: All Maintenance is Expensive

While some repairs can be costly, regular maintenance can actually save money in the long run by preventing major issues.

Myth 5: If My Car Isn't Overheating, My Cooling System is Fine

Cooling systems can have underlying issues that may not present immediate symptoms. Regular checks are vital to avoid potential overheating.
